On December 10, 2025, at the initiative of the Chamber of Commerce and Industry of the Republic of Tajikistan, which chairs the Council of Heads of Chambers of the CIS Member States, a meeting of representatives of the chambers of commerce and industry of the Commonwealth of Independent States was held via videoconference, the press service of the Organization's Executive Committee reported.
The event was attended by representatives of chambers and business communities from Armenia,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Russia, Tajikistan, and Uzbekistan, as well as representatives of the CIS Executive Committee, the Skolkovo Foundation, VDNKh JSC, and the CIS Business Center.


Nasim Anvarov, First Deputy Chairman of the Chamber of Commerce and Industry of Tajikistan, addressed the participants with a welcoming speech. Adolat Mirzoshoeva, Head of the Department for Interaction with International Organizations at the Chamber of Commerce and Industry of Tajikistan, chaired the meeting.
The meeting addressed key agenda items, including the participation of the chambers of commerce and industry in the implementation of the Interstate Program for Innovative Cooperation of the CIS Member States through 2030. Participants discussed the experience of forming industry working groups within the SCO Business Council, the mutual application of electronic systems for certification of origin of goods, the introduction of product identification marking, and the mutual recognition of marking codes between countries. The organization of a roundtable discussion on exhibition and trade fair activities was also discussed.
Timur Mansurov, a representative of the CIS Executive Committee and head of the Department of Scientific, Technical Cooperation and Innovation of the Department of Economic Cooperation, noted the Executive Committee's coordinating role in the implementation of the Interstate Program for Innovative Cooperation of CIS Member States and invited the chambers to submit their proposals for inclusion in the draft Comprehensive Action Plan for 2026–2030 for the implementation of this program.
In addition, the participants discussed preparations for the next meeting of the Council of Heads of Chambers of the CIS Member States, which is planned to be held in the first half of 2026.
